
LANSDOWN GROVE HOTEL
Perched on the side of Lansdown Hill with panoramic views overlooking Bath. Lansdown Grove is one of Bath's only 4* hotels to have its own private car park. The Lansdown Grove has been a prominent Georgian mansion since 1770, all within a stone’s throw of Bath's best-known attractions. 61 newly refurbished bedrooms mixing the heritage character of Georgian Bath with contemporary comforts of a modern hotel. The 1913 restaurant & bar adds that touch of class to your stay, whether it’s a delicious breakfast, candlelit dinner or a nightcap in the library.
